What Key Features Define the Best Mid Range Wall Ovens?

The best mid-range wall ovens are defined by features that enhance cooking performance, convenience, and efficiency.

  1. Self-cleaning function
  2. Convection cooking
  3. Smart technology integration
  4. Even heat distribution
  5. Adjustable racks
  6. Multiple cooking modes
  7. Energy efficiency
  8. Aesthetic design options
  9. User-friendly controls

With these features in mind, let’s delve deeper into each aspect to understand their significance.

  1. Self-Cleaning Function: The self-cleaning function in wall ovens simplifies maintenance. It uses high temperatures to burn off food residue, leaving behind ash that can be easily wiped away. According to a study conducted by Consumer Reports, self-cleaning ovens save about 30 to 60 minutes per cleaning cycle compared to manual cleaning methods.

  2. Convection Cooking: Convection cooking utilizes a fan to circulate heated air around the food. This results in more even cooking and browning. Research from the National Institute of Standards and Technology indicates that convection ovens can reduce cooking times by up to 25%, making them efficient choices for busy lifestyles.

  3. Smart Technology Integration: Smart technology enables users to control their wall ovens remotely through mobile applications. Features such as recipe suggestions and cooking notifications enhance usability. A report by Statista noted that about 30% of consumers in 2023 prioritize connected devices in kitchen appliances.

  4. Even Heat Distribution: Even heat distribution is vital for consistent cooking results. Advanced heating elements and design features help prevent hot spots and cold areas. A well-regarded brand, Bosch, emphasizes this factor in their models, stating that even heat contributes to better baking results.

  5. Adjustable Racks: Adjustable racks offer flexibility for different cooking tasks. This feature allows cooks to customize the oven space according to the size and type of dishes being prepared. The presence of multiple rack positions increases usability and maximizes cooking capacity.

  6. Multiple Cooking Modes: Wall ovens with various cooking modes, such as bake, broil, roast, and air fry, provide versatility. This feature allows users to experiment with different recipes and cooking techniques. A survey from Kitchen Appliance Trends indicated that consumers appreciate ovens that cater to diverse cooking styles.

  7. Energy Efficiency: Energy-efficient wall ovens reduce electricity costs and environmental impact. Many models are designed with energy-saving features, earning them Energy Star certification. According to the EPA, Energy Star appliances can save consumers up to 30% in energy costs over typical models.

  8. Aesthetic Design Options: Wall ovens come in various designs and finishes to match kitchen aesthetics. Consumers often value a cohesive kitchen look. A study by the National Kitchen and Bath Association highlights that nearly 40% of homeowners consider appliance design a critical selection factor.

  9. User-Friendly Controls: Intuitive controls enhance the user experience. Touchscreen interfaces and clearly labeled dials make operation straightforward. Research shows that 70% of users prefer simple, accessible controls, especially in high-traffic cooking environments.

How Do Various Cooking Technologies Affect Wall Oven Performance?

Various cooking technologies influence wall oven performance by affecting heating method, efficiency, cooking time, and even the texture of food. Key factors include convection cooking, microwave integration, and traditional thermal cooking.

Convection cooking: Convection ovens use a fan and exhaust system to circulate hot air around food. This technology cooks food more evenly and can reduce cooking times by about 25%. A study by Schmidt and Rolf (2020) showed that convection baking results in better browning and crisping due to more consistent heat distribution.

Microwave integration: Some modern wall ovens combine traditional heating with microwave technology. This integration allows for faster cooking and reheating while retaining moisture. Research by Zhang et al. (2021) confirmed that microwave-assisted cooking reduces cooking times while preserving nutrient content in certain foods.

Traditional thermal cooking: Traditional thermal ovens, utilizing radiant heat from heating elements, provide a reliable cooking method. However, they may have hot and cold spots, leading to uneven cooking. According to Johnson and Lee (2019), thermal cooking often requires longer cooking times, especially for larger dishes.

Energy efficiency: The technology type often impacts energy consumption. For example, convection ovens are generally more energy-efficient compared to traditional thermal ovens. The U.S. Department of Energy (2022) reported that convection ovens can save up to 20% more energy.

Cooking time: Different technologies affect total cooking time. Convection technology typically reduces cooking times by providing quicker heat transfer. On the other hand, traditional ovens often take longer due to lack of air circulation.

Texture and flavor: The cooking method influences the final texture and flavor of the food. Convection ovens create a crispy exterior due to even heat distribution, which can enhance the taste and appeal of roasted or baked dishes.

These technologies shape wall oven performance by enhancing cooking quality, speed, efficiency, and the overall culinary experience.
